What is the synonym for microorganisms, which are living entities too small to be observed without a microscope?

Explanation:
Microbial agents is a broad term that encompasses all types of microorganisms, including bacteria, viruses, fungi, and protozoa. This description aligns well with the definition of microorganisms as living entities that are typically too small to be seen without the aid of a microscope. The term 'microbial agents' captures the diverse nature of these entities and acknowledges their roles in various ecological and health-related contexts. The other choices are more specific and do not encompass the entire range of microorganisms. Bacteria, while certainly a type of microorganism, is too narrow a term to serve as a synonym for all microorganisms. Viruses, although also considered microorganisms, are not classified as living in the traditional sense since they require a host to replicate. Pathogens refer specifically to microorganisms that cause disease, which again is a more limited subset of the broader category of microorganisms. Therefore, microbial agents is the most accurate synonym for the term in question.
